Product Description

Product Description

Letts Explore contain a thorough analysis of the plot and structure of key examination texts. GCSE Of Mice and Men helps students to fully understand the text in detail. In addition to helping prepare for the exam, this handy literature guide covers the literature as well as how students will be tested in the exam.

•Gives in-depth exploration of characters and themes
•Includes tips, guidance and quizzes to reinforce knowledge
•Contain key quotations from the texts

As a teacher I have shared this excellent novel with probably thousands of teenagers over the years. I buy all the study guides to check them out for my students. This guide is on the recommended list!

Chapter summaries, character reviews and pointers towards examination questions are all present and thoughtful. This is certainly a useful read for people studying the novel for GCSE.

My only quibble is that perhaps it does not explore themes in sufficient detail for students aiming for the very top grades - but then, to be fair, they probably don't need a guide.

This is certainly very good value for money.

Accessible and comprehensive GCSE study guide for John Steinbeck's seminal Depression era novel. If you are in Y10 or Y11 and studying this text then I urge you to make buying this an absolute priority. What I would say too is that it's NOT a substitute for reading the novel - read the novel at least once then dip into this. Superb.

I was given this study guide to use when revising for my English Litrature GCSE exam.
I found the tips and the generalisation very very useful and the excercises given to complete were of use, unlike some guides that give difficult offputting questions.
The language within the guide is not too simple and not to complex, which makes it an ideal guide as it does not intimidate or put one off revising.
I like the guide's size aswell, as it was easy to store in a small bag meaning that it was always availible for referance if I had a few minutes spare.
I achieved an A grade using this guide in the 2007 GCSE exam, so I would highly reccommend purchasing this guide for the English Lit exam.
